Are you looking for a role where you can lead, inspire, and make a real impact? We’re seeking a Policy Analysis Operations Manager to join our Counter Fraud Services (CFS) Policy Analysis (PA) team at First Central on a 9-month fixed-term contract.
The PA team is responsible for validating new and existing customer policies flagged for application fraud or misrepresentation, ensuring customers are insured correctly at the right rate. As PA Operations Manager, you’ll oversee PA operations and contact centres, playing a key role in achieving the team’s objectives.
You will lead around 8 teams and 80 colleagues, driving an exceptional contact centre experience, maintaining engagement, supporting career growth, and ensuring department metrics and SLA targets are met. If you thrive in a fast-paced, people-focused environment, we’d love to hear from you!
